Biography

Music from Austin, Texas? Blues, country, folk  yeah, sure, but punk? Yeah, you bet, and the Riddlin' Kids are an example of just that.

Austin natives Clint Baker (vocals, guitar) and Dustin Stroud (guitar, vocals) first met when they were both working at the same pizza place. They each quit the bands they were playing with and teamed up. Their hyperactive stage presence prompted the naming of the group after the same named hyperactive children's drug. Spelled Riddlin' Kids to avoid any unnecessary legal problems, the group cut an EP, What Does It Matter. About this time, Dave Keel (drums) joined the group and later Mark Johnson (bass) completed the roster.

The Kids continued to gig, landing opening slots for the likes of Fenix TX, Newfound Glory, and others. Another demo garnered them airplay on Austin's KROX and a spot on the station's Top 50 year-end playlist. More supporting slots followed (Staind, BossTones, etc.) and appearances at the Gravity Games and the Warped tour stop in Austin. In 2001, the Kids copped the trophy for Best Alt Rock/Punk Band at the Austin Music Awards.

In 2002, Riddlin' Kids released its debut album, Hurry Up and Wait. The album landed on the charts and the group toured.
